Landon pulled an evidence bag from the kit in his trunk and slid the pick in. “I’ll run it for prints as soon as I get back to the station.”
Cole leaned against the patrol car, adrenaline surging through his body. “Is that what I think it is?”
“If you’re thinking it’s a lock pick, then you’re right.”
Piper rubbed her arms, looking up and down the dark street.
Fear gnawed at Cole’s gut. “I was afraid of that. So someone did try to break in. If I hadn’t been on the phone with her at the time, who knows what could have happened.”
“Can’t be positive.”
“How else can you explain the pick?” Piper asked.
“Like Bailey said, we don’t know how long it’s been there. Maybe Miss Agnes used it to open old jewelry boxes that were missing their key or something. We can’t jump to conclusions.”
Cole raked a hand through his hair. “I don’t like it.”
“Neither do I, but there’s nothing else we can do at this point. She didn’t actually see anyone enter and as far as she can tell nothing’s missing. Other than this pick—which may or may not have had any other uses—there’s no sign of a break-in.”
“I heard the cat screech. He saw something or someone.”
“Probably made whoever was using this drop it.” Landon sealed the evidence bag. “Hopefully, we’ll be lucky and get some prints.”
“And if there are none?” Working emergency services, Cole had been privy to enough crime scenes to know that prints were a luxury.
“We’ll cross that bridge when we come to it. I’ll let you get back to Bailey, and I’ll get this pick into evidence.”
“Wait, what did you want to talk to us about?”
Landon glanced at Bailey through the window. “It can wait till morning.”
“You sure?”
“Absolutely. She needs your undivided attention right now.” Landon helped Piper into his car and then moved around to the driver’s side. “Make sure Bailey locks up tight, and I’ll drive back by after I take Piper home.”
Cole tapped the roof. “Thanks, man.”
“Anytime.”
